    What Is a Rollator For Tall Person?

    A rollator designed for tall people, or tall walker, is a mobility aid that features longer legs than regular walkers. This aid aids the user to stand up straight, improves posture and reduces back pain.

    They also have a adjustable height handles. This will ensure that the user is comfortable with their walking aid.

    Seat Height

    If you are a tall person, it's important to select a rollator that has the correct seat height. This will enable you to walk without straining over the handlebars. You can also find models that have a removable backrest, which allows you to customize the height to meet your requirements.

    Another aspect to look out for in a rollator for tall people is the size of the seat. This is important if you need to sit down for long periods of time. The higher-backed seats offer more comfort and support. You can also buy accessories for your rollator, such as the tray that can hold food and beverages and oxygen tanks or canes.

    Handle Height

    The handles of walkers for taller individuals are higher than those on standard models in order to accommodate the user's height. This feature helps improve posture and reduce stress on the back and shoulders by removing the need to sit down when using the device. This feature also decreases the risk of falling due to an accidental trip. Many tall walkers have a seat that lets the user take a break from walking for long periods.

    It is crucial to accurately measure your height in selecting a rolling device that is appropriate for the tallest person. Sit straight with your back against a wall and take measurements from the top of your head to the floor. This measurement will help find the best walker or collapsible rollator walker that is suitable for you. Also, it's a good idea to test-drive the device by sitting in it and grabbing the handles before making the purchase.

    Brakes

    A rollator is a aid to mobility that can help users with their balance and stability. A rollator is more comfortable than a standard walker designed for taller individuals due to its a wider base, a movable seat and larger front wheels. It is designed to accommodate people over 6 feet tall.

    A large part of the benefits from using a taller model of rollator is the brakes, which make it simpler for individuals to stop whenever they want to, and also give additional support when walking aid rollator on uneven or slippery surfaces. There are several types of brakes available for rollators, and it's important to find the one that's appropriate to your requirements.

    Loop lock brakes are typically recognized by the plastic loops that are parallel to the handle grips. The loops can be squeezed in order to slow down the walker or lock it, and then be released by pressing them downward. Some models have internal brake cables that are sleeved in the walker frame, which could be useful in homes with tight spaces where the brake cables may be caught on furniture or other objects.

    The design of the handle is a crucial aspect to consider when looking for an a rolling. Different manufacturers design their handles differently. Handles can be a bar that has no loop or closure, or a semi-closed hand with an opening or a loop that is closed. If your hands are more than average, you must select a model that has closed loop handles.

    It's also important to think about whether you'd like your rollator to have a seat, as some models come with a seat for extra comfort and convenience. A seat that is cushioned can make it easier for you to sit down whenever you're required to and also provide your back a bit more support when you're sitting. A seat is also helpful for those who plan to travel with your tall rollator. It'll make it easier to take breaks when you're on the go.

    Weight Capacity

    While a standard rollator is fine for most individuals but it can pose a problem for taller individuals. Using one that's not a good fit can lead to discomfort and even serious injuries like back, shoulder, or joint problems. There are walker models that are specifically designed for people who are taller to ensure maximum comfort and security.

    Tall walker rollators are typically made with larger handles and longer legs to fit a person's height. This can also keep people from having to bend which can improve posture and lessen back pain. Most walker models designed for taller individuals have extra-large wheels, which are designed to cope with more difficult terrain than standard walkers.
